Yurtec Stadium Sendai
Stadium
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Yurtec Stadium Sendai is a football stadium in the Nanakita Park, Izumi-ku, Sendai City, Miyagi Prefecture, Japan. Built in 1997, it is home to Vegalta Sendai, Mynavi Sendai Ladies and Sony Sendai. Yurtec Stadium Sendai is situated 420 metres east of Yusuizan.
Izumi-Chūō Station
Metro station
Photo: Ymblanter,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Izumi-Chūō Station is a terminal underground metro station on the Sendai Subway Nanboku Line in Izumi-ku, Sendai, Miyagi Prefecture, Japan. In 2023, the sub-station has named Vegalta Sendai·Yursta-mae. Izumi-Chūō Station is situated 530 metres northeast of Yusuizan.
Futahashira Shrine
Shinto shrine
Photo: Naokijp,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Futahashira Shrine is a Shinto shrine located in Sendai, Miyagi Prefecture, Japan. The main kami enshrined here are Izanagi and Izanami. Futahashira Shrine is situated 770 metres east of Yusuizan.

Aoba
Suburb
Photo: 掬茶,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Aoba-ku is one of five wards of Sendai, the largest city in the Tōhoku region of Japan. Aoba-ku encompasses 302.278 km² and had a population of 296,551, with 147,622 households as of March 1, 2012. Aoba is situated 6 km south of Yusuizan.
Miyagino
Suburb
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Miyagino-ku is the northeastern ward of the city Sendai, in Miyagi Prefecture, Japan. As of 1 July 2017, the ward had a population of 196,086 and a population density of 3370 persons per km2 in 91322 households. Miyagino is situated 7 km southeast of Yusuizan.
